Biaxials 0°/90° in natural fibres
Fibres Recherche Développement - FRD
The biaxial 0°/90° are generally fabrics composed of a regular assembly of flax or hemp yarns arranged perpendicularly in a specific arrangement called pattern. Structure provides good mechanical performance in both directions 0° and 90°.Last update 15/07/2014 -

Unidirectionnel flax fiber reinforcements
TDL Technique / Terre de Lin
Unidirectional flax fibers reinforcement made by parallelized flax slivers, maintained by sewing between 2 polyester fabrics
Weight: 120 g/m² of flax+ 2 polyester fabrics (20g/m²), 200 g/m² of flax+ 2 polyester fabrics (35g/m²), 400 g/m² of flax+ 2 polyester fabrics (35g/m²)
Packaging: rolls of 120 m², width of 1220 mmLast update 14/11/2016
